pub struct RemixVideoRequestArgs { /* private fields */ }Expand description
Builder for RemixVideoRequest.
Implementations§
Source§impl RemixVideoRequestArgs
impl RemixVideoRequestArgs
pub fn prompt<VALUE: Into<String>>(&mut self, value: VALUE) -> &mut Self
Sourcepub fn build(&self) -> Result<RemixVideoRequest, OpenAIError>
pub fn build(&self) -> Result<RemixVideoRequest, OpenAIError>
Trait Implementations§
Source§impl Clone for RemixVideoRequestArgs
impl Clone for RemixVideoRequestArgs
Source§fn clone(&self) -> RemixVideoRequestArgs
fn clone(&self) -> RemixVideoRequestArgs
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for RemixVideoRequestArgs
impl Debug for RemixVideoRequestArgs
Auto Trait Implementations§
impl Freeze for RemixVideoRequestArgs
impl RefUnwindSafe for RemixVideoRequestArgs
impl Send for RemixVideoRequestArgs
impl Sync for RemixVideoRequestArgs
impl Unpin for RemixVideoRequestArgs
impl UnwindSafe for RemixVideoRequestArgs
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more